Getting Started With Personal Injury Law: What You Ought to Know

What vital information is necessary to understand the world of personal injury law? Knowing key concepts is vital for anyone trying to grasp this legal field. Personal injury law primarily focuses on cases where individuals sustain damage due to the negligence or wrongful acts of others. It involves various types of accidents, including vehicular collisions, slip and falls, and medical malpractice.

People should be conscious of the statute of limitations, which determines the timeframe within which a claim must be filed. Understanding with terms such as negligence, liability, and damages is also essential. Knowing the value of evidence collection, including documentation of injuries and accident reports, can significantly impact the outcome of a case. Finally, recognizing the role of personal injury lawyers, who provide essential guidance and representation, is vital for navigating this complex legal landscape, ensuring that victims receive the compensation they deserve.

Knowing Your Rights

Comprehending a person's rights regarding a personal injury claim is crucial for those seeking compensation after an accident. Accident victims are able to seek damages for medical expenses, lost wages, pain and suffering, and other related costs. It is critical for individuals to be aware of the statute of limitations, which sets a deadline for filing a claim. Moreover, victims have the right to pursue compensation from negligent parties, including insurance companies, and can decide to negotiate settlements or proceed to litigation. Hiring a personal injury lawyer can help victims navigate these complexities, making sure their rights are protected throughout the process. Finally, understanding these rights empowers victims to make informed decisions concerning their claims.

Collecting Vital Evidence

Acquiring evidence is a essential step in the personal injury claim process that directly influences the outcome of a case. Crucial evidence includes medical records, photographs of the accident scene, witness statements, and police reports. Each piece of evidence helps prove liability and demonstrate the magnitude of injuries. Accident victims should also keep a detailed account of their recovery process, including medical treatments and expenses, as this documentation supports their claims. Moreover, collecting information about the other party involved, such as insurance details, is critical. Engaging a personal injury lawyer can additionally streamline this process, ensuring that all relevant evidence is meticulously gathered and preserved, ultimately strengthening the victim's case for compensation.

Securing Equitable Compensation

How do accident victims effectively negotiate fair compensation for their injuries? Initially, they should recognize the full extent of their damages, including medical expenses, lost wages, and pain and suffering. Compiling thorough evidence, such as medical records and witness statements, strengthens their position. Following this, victims must establish clear communication with insurance adjusters, presenting a well-organized claim that outlines all relevant facts and documentation. It is essential to remain patient and avoid settling for the first offer, as initial proposals are often lower than warranted. Accident victims may benefit from consulting a personal injury lawyer, who can provide expertise in negotiations and ensure that their rights are protected throughout the process. In the end, tenacity and preparation are key to achieving fair compensation.

Particular Categories of Personal Injury Claims and How Attorneys Can Assist

Personal injury matters include numerous types of occurrences, including car key resource accidents and slip-and-fall situations to medical malpractice and product liability claims. Every case category brings distinct obstacles that require specialized legal knowledge. For example, in car accident cases, lawyers compile evidence, assess liability, and negotiate with insurance companies to secure fair compensation for victims. In slip-and-fall incidents, attorneys investigate safety violations and establish premises liability. Medical malpractice cases require complex medical records and expert witness testimonies to prove negligence by healthcare professionals. Product liability claims demand thorough analysis of manufacturing practices and safety standards. Personal injury lawyers play an vital role in maneuvering the intricacies of these cases, ensuring victims understand their rights and options. By leveraging their expertise, attorneys help clients obtain the compensation they deserve for medical expenses, lost wages, and pain and suffering resulting from their injuries.

Choosing the Right Personal Injury Legal Professional

Selecting the right personal injury attorney can significantly impact the outcome of a case. Potential clients should examine several key factors when making this crucial decision. First, it is vital to evaluate the attorney's experience specifically in personal injury law, as this expertise can provide invaluable insights and strategies. Additionally, reviewing their track record of successful cases can help assess their effectiveness in securing favorable settlements or verdicts.

Clients should also assess the lawyer's communication style and approachability, as a strong attorney-client relationship can enhance collaboration throughout the legal process. In addition, understanding the fee structure is essential; many personal injury lawyers function on a contingency fee basis, meaning they only get paid if the client wins the case. Lastly, seeking recommendations from friends or family, or reading online reviews, can deliver additional guidance in selecting a reliable and skilled personal injury lawyer.

Critical Missteps to Evade in Your Personal Injury Claim

When people pursue a personal injury claim, overlooking vital details can dramatically harm their case. One widespread mistake is failing to document the incident thoroughly. Without concrete evidence, such as photographs, witness statements, and medical records, establishing liability becomes hard. Furthermore, waiting to seek medical treatment can weaken a claim; immediate medical attention not only guarantees proper recovery but also serves as crucial documentation of injuries.

An additional error is offering recorded statements to insurance firms without legal guidance, which can lead to unintentional admissions that undermine the claim. Additionally, many individuals underestimate the long-term consequences of their injuries, accepting less than they deserve. Ultimately, neglecting to adhere to statutory deadlines can cause losing the right to file a claim altogether. Avoiding these mistakes is essential for maximizing the chances of a successful personal injury claim.

FAQ

How Much Does It Cost to Hire a Personal Injury Lawyer?

Personal injury legal professionals commonly charge a contingency fee, ranging from 25%-40% of the settlement amount. This fee structure permits clients to pay only if they win their case, reducing upfront financial burdens.

How Long Does a Personal Injury Case Usually Take to Resolve?

The average time to resolve a personal injury case typically ranges from several months to a few years. Case complexity, negotiation workflows, and court scheduling are key factors that influence this timeframe, considerably impacting the overall resolution timeline.

May I Represent Myself in a Personal Injury Claim?

Individuals are able to represent themselves in personal injury claims. However, doing so may lead to challenges in maneuvering through legal complexities, understanding procedures, and effectively negotiating settlements, potentially impacting the outcome of their case.

What if I Share Some Fault for the Accident?

You may still be able to pursue a claim even when the accident was partly your fault. Your compensation may be decreased according to your fault percentage, however, emphasizing the importance of understanding liability in personal injury cases.

How Do I Know Whether My Personal Injury Case Has Merit?

To identify whether a valid personal injury case exists, one must examine factors such as negligence, the extent of injuries, and whether damages can be verified. Seeking guidance from legal experts can offer clarity and guidance in this review.
